I’ve speculated that possibility for some time, but apparently mPower technology has been able to achieve such innovation The company’s potential customers have already tried out several prototypes based on this technology, called Dragon SCALES (“SemiConductor Active Layer Embedded Solar”).

These panels are also made of silicon, like the standard model, but the internal architecture consists of a flexible network of tiny solar cells. It is this ‘fragmented’ structure that makes these flexible solar panels possible and thus easier to transport. A standard model housed in a five-foot-long glass panel, something that’s not possible.

Thanks to this new manufacturing process, the satellite will be able to carry folded pieces of solar panels into space and unfold them when it reaches orbit. Caravans could carry them in trunks they set up at campsites to take advantage of solar power, and they could even be folded and carried in jacket pockets.
According to their creators, their network structure makes them last longer, more resistant, require less raw materials, and are cheaper to install.
